Socorro/Release Process: Difference between revisions

From MozillaWiki
Jump to navigation Jump to search
(quick outline)
 
(typo)
Line 5: Line 5:
== Code freeze ==
== Code freeze ==
* code is branched per https://wiki.mozilla.org/Socorro/Release_Branch_Strategy
* code is branched per https://wiki.mozilla.org/Socorro/Release_Branch_Strategy
* staging data is refreshed and new build is loaded to branch staging server (crash-stats.allizom.org0
* staging data is refreshed and new build is loaded to branch staging server (crash-stats.allizom.org)


== Verification ==
== Verification ==

Revision as of 19:41, 29 June 2011

New feature/bugfix

  • Socorro bugs are triaged and "Target Milestone" field in bugzilla is set
  • As bugs are resolved, QA verifies them against the trunk staging server (crash-stats-dev.allizom.org)

Code freeze

Verification

  • QA verifies fixes against branch staging server
    • Socorro devs verify logs on each server:
      • /var/log/socorro/*.log
      • /var/log/socorro/kohana/*.php

Push to production

  • When QA signs off, a push bug in mozilla.org/Server Ops
    • for example see: bug 667819
    • Socorro devs verify logs on each server:
      • /var/log/socorro/*.log
      • /var/log/socorro/kohana/*.php